Types of Scholarships to Study in Georgia

When planning your academic journey, it’s vital to understand what types of scholarships you can expect:

  • Merit-Based Scholarships: Awarded to students with strong academic backgrounds, high test scores, or exceptional achievements.
  • Need-Based Scholarships: Offered to students who demonstrate financial need, reducing the barriers for deserving candidates.
  • Government Scholarships: Structured support by Georgian or bilateral government initiatives for international students.
  • Institutional Grants & Discounts: Many institutions in Georgia provide partial tuition waivers to international students.
  • Subject-Specific Awards: Scholarships tied to disciplines such as medicine, engineering, or business.

How to Secure a Scholarship in Georgia: A Practical Pathway

Securing funding requires strategy and preparation, not last-minute applications. Below is a structured approach:

  1. Start Early: Begin research at least 8–10 months before your intake.
  2. Prepare Strong Applications: Build a compelling Statement of Purpose (SOP), updated CV, and collect recommendation letters.
  3. Ace Standardised Tests: Some scholarships require English proficiency or entrance exams. Test scores like IELTS, TOEFL, or PTE can boost chances.
  4. Highlight Achievements: Academic scores, extracurricular leadership, and volunteer work are all considered.
  5. Submit Before Deadlines: Applications often close months before classes begin. Late submissions drastically reduce chances.
  6. Stay Organised: Track multiple scholarship timelines, required documents, and follow-up communications.

Estimated Costs vs Scholarships in Georgia

One of the major attractions of Georgia is affordability. Let’s put it in perspective:

  • Average Tuition (before scholarships): ₹2.5 – ₹5 lakhs per year
  • Living Expenses: ₹15,000 – ₹25,000 per month (accommodation, food, transport)
  • Scholarship Coverage: Ranges from 20% to 75% depending on merit and programme type

With even a partial scholarship, the overall cost becomes significantly lighter compared to studying in destinations like the US or UK.

Note: All prices mentioned are approximate values. Students should check official government websites or the respective university websites for exact figures.
